Output 642afc65d2b0ea8f8331f6c78744c2439fa30062fddca72b225e3059801429e1:13

value
1879923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c61ce9820dafbfc720c5be65010a0d785f6916b OP_EQUAL
address
3MnHkVkfRtcMJjdrmqPdQmr7Ev72nfHwfH
transaction
642afc65d2b0ea8f8331f6c78744c2439fa30062fddca72b225e3059801429e1
spent
true